Acts 10:15 Cross References - Godbey

15 And the voice again the second time came to him, Whatsoever things God has cleansed, do not count unclean;

Matthew 15:11

11 That if which cometh into the mouth does not defile the man; but that which cometh out from the mouth, that defiles the man.

Mark 7:19

19 Because it does not go into his heart, but into his stomach, and is cast out into the excrement, purifying all edibles.

Acts 10:28

28 and he said to them, You know how it is an unlawful thing for a Jewish man to associate with, or come to one of another nation; and God has shown me not to call any man unconsecrated or unclean.

Acts 11:9

9 And a voice a second time was heard from heaven, Whatsoever things God has cleansed, consider thou not unconsecrated.

Acts 15:9

9 and made no difference between us and them, purifying their hearts by faith.

Acts 15:20

20 but to command them to abstain from things offered to idols, and from fornication, and from strangulation, and from blood.

Acts 15:29

29 to abstain from things offered to idols, and from blood, and from things strangled, and from fornication: from which keeping yourselves, you will do well. Fare ye well.

Romans 14:14

14 I know, and am persuaded in the Lord Jesus, that there is nothing unclean of itself: except to him who considers it unclean, to him it is unclean.

Romans 14:20

20 Do not destroy the work of God on account of meat. All things are pure; but it is evil to the man who eats with offence:

1 Corinthians 10:25

25 Eat everything which is sold in market, asking no questions on account of conscience;

Galatians 2:12-13

12 For before certain ones came from James, he was eating along with the Gentiles: but when they came, he withdrew and separated himself, fearing those who were of the circumcision. 13 And the rest of the Jews also reciprocated with him; so that even Barnabas was led away by their dissimulation.

1 Timothy 4:3-5

3 forbidding to marry, commanding to abstain from meats, which God created for reception with thanksgiving to the faithful and to those perfectly knowing the truth. 4 Because every creature of God is good, and nothing rejected, being received with thanksgiving: 5 for it is sanctified by the word of God and by prayer.

Titus 1:15

15 To the pure all things are pure: but to the corrupted and unbelieving there is nothing pure; yea, their mind and their conscience are polluted.

Hebrews 9:9-10

9 which is a figure unto the present time, in which gifts and sacrifices are offered, not being able to make the worshiper perfect, as to his conscience; 10 consisting only in meats and drinks, and divers baptisms, ordinances of the flesh, abiding until the time of restitution.
